ESP32-C3-DEVKITC-02U
Overview
The ESP32-C3-DEVKITC-02U is an Espressif development board built around the ESP32-C3-WROOM-02U module. It provides a 32-bit RISC-V single-core processor (up to 160 MHz), built-in 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i and Bluetooth Low Energy, and a rich set of peripherals for prototyping wireless IoT devices.
Why Choose This Part
Provides an integrated, ready-to-use development platform with the ESP32-C3 RISC-V core plus both Wi-Fi and BLE radios, reducing time-to-prototype. It exposes a large set of peripherals (UART, SPI, I2C, I2S, RMT, PWM, ADC, GDMA, TWAI) and about 22 GPIOs, making it flexible for sensor and network integrations. The board is supported by Espressif toolchains and firmware ecosystems for rapid software development.

Getting Started
Use Espressif ESP-IDF as the primary SDK; the board is also supported by the Arduino Core for ESP32-C3 for simpler projects. Install Espressif toolchain (xtensa or RISC-V toolchain as required), the cp210x/CDC USB drivers if needed, and follow Espressif's getting-started docs for flashing via the on-board USB Serial/JTAG. Example projects and libraries are available from Espressif's GitHub repositories.
